Firearm safety principles |
• treat all firearms as if it is loaded •never let your muzzle cross anything you aren't willing to destroy •keep your finger off the Tigger untill you have formed the intention to fire •ensure of your intended target and threat |

When to carry out safety precautions |
•when firearm is picked up or received from another person •handing the firearm to another •before stripping or cleaning •before and after every firearm •whenever there is doubt that the firearm is clear |
